Kenyan Wanted For Murder of Girlfriend in US Escapes From Nairobi Police Station

Kelvin Kinyanjui Kange’the who was arrested after allegedly murdering his girlfriend in the US before fleeing to Kenya has escaped from Muthaiga Police Station.

Several reports allege that the suspect escaped from the station on Wednesday, February 7 evening, jumped onto a matatu, and fled to an unknown destination.

The suspect had requested to meet his lawyer at the station before escaping.

By the time of this publication, police had not issued a detailed statement of how the suspect escaped from a well-guarded police station in the city.

However, reports indicate that a manhunt has been launched to re-arrest the suspect wanted in the US on allegations of murdering his girlfriend, Margaret Mbitu and leaving her body at the airport.

He had been detained at the police cells pending a ruling on whether he should be extradited to the US to face murder charges there in connection with the death of Mbitu on October 31, 2023.

Kangethe was arrested in Nairobi’s Westlands area on January 30 where he was partying. His arrest made headlines with the US authorities praising Kenya for making a breakthrough in serving justice to the family of the deceased.
